Subject: On-call handoff — Echowend audio-guide app

Hey, welcome to the rotation! Quick heads-up before your first shift: the Echowend museum audio-guide app is generally quiet, but gallery wifi dead zones cause a burst of failed audio downloads every weekend, and those alerts look scarier than they are. The real thing to watch is the content sync job that pushes new exhibit tracks — if it fails before a Friday release, hold the rollout and ping me. Release gating rules and the rollback steps are on the internal page below.

wiki page, tahaf-tajog: https://jira.ordindyn.corp/pipeline

**Handover — metrics sidecar (Thornquist → Abeline).** The Copperline aggregation sidecar batches gauges every 10s and flushes to the Marrow collector. Watch the drop counter after deploys; a nonzero value usually means the buffer is undersized. Restarts are safe — state is in-memory only. The sidecar boots with the following configuration values.

config for tawif-bagef:
[sorwyn]
team = sorys
access_code = ac_9ba40c
host = sorwyn.ordingrid.local
port = 5000
owner = aldok.quenion
peer = belath.paliqcloud.local

The Quillbase nightly reindex rebuilds the full-text search shards for all tenant catalogs at 02:00 server time. New team members should know the job is idempotent: if a run fails mid-shard, the next invocation resumes from the last committed checkpoint rather than starting over. You can trigger a manual reindex via POST /admin/reindex, which accepts an optional tenant filter. Requests must include the service bearer token shown below in the Authorization header.

portal login ticket: eyJhbGciOiJIUzI1NiIsInR5cCI6IkpXVCJ9.eyJzdWIiOiIwEOsktwVNwIn0.-UJU3fdyyCgG

Subject: Quickstore 4.2 — bloom filter now fronts the KV layer

Plugin authors: starting with this release, Quickstore places a bloom filter ahead of the key-value store. Negative lookups return faster; false positives fall through safely. No API changes are required on your side. Verify your plugin against the staging build referenced below.

session token of fahif-tadup = htk3_9c7